The Fundamentals of Metal Polishing - Most frequently, the finishing of metal is needed for aesthetics and for clean-room usages. It's among the most prominent solutions because of its use in intensifying the overall attractiveness of the product, for example, motorcycle parts, automotive parts or kitchenware. What's more, many clean-rooms need a shiny finish in an effort to decrease the permeability of the material that will cause dust to build up and contaminate. A superb example of this implementation might be in a vacuum chamber.

There are certainly a great number of means to polish metal, and now I will discuss a bit pertaining to several of the processes involved. Various metals may be polished by means of chemicals, electromechanically, using specialized buffing machines, or maybe manually. A special polishing paste or compound is frequently utilised, which could contain aluminum oxide, tripoli, limestone, chalk, chromium oxide, dolomite, or iron oxide.

Buffing stainless steel, because of its weak th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its reasonably high viscidness is in general one of the most time-consuming. On the flip side, items produced with non-ferrous metal are more amenable to polishing, since these need the least number of processes.

Finishing buffs daubed in paste are profoundly impacted by specific force on the pad. The level of the pressure on the surface might be increased within certain ranges, although further exceeding the right degree of load not simply reduces the quality of the procedure, but additionally can worsen performance, can create wear on the product, and in addition an apparent heating up of the work-pieces, an outcome of friction. When working thin items, it will be raised heat (and the resulting bendability of the metal) that will probably cause items to warp, distort, or bend. Usually, it will take a competent polisher to factor in all of these variables to equally not cause damage to the part and to operate successfully. To be able to significantly enhance the standard of the resultant surface, the finishing procedure will have to be completed with reduced power and not a large amount of force so that you will finally produce a surface area with no scratches or marks as a consequence of the polishing procedure, thus ending up with a fantastic mirror finish.
